    Because "The Ballad of John and Yoko" and "Old Brown Shoe" are on Past Masters, I think the AR50 box will include outtakes of those songs but not the remixed masters.

    It's my contention that the masters of any tracks that are on PM are being held for a remixed Past Masters release that'll just be the tracks and no outtakes. Therefore the outtakes go with the set of the album (or nearest album) to their sessions.

    "Penny Lane" and "Strawberry Fields Forever" were included in the Pepper50 box (to much fanfare) because those two songs are not on Past Masters, and at that point Apple wasn't sure it would ever do a MMT deluxe music-focused box or any further deluxe boxes for that matter. After Pepper50 was a hit commercially and critically, Apple probably greenlit plans to do more box sets, as we are starting to see, and will stick to this rule so they don't make Past Masters obsolete by using all these tracks on album box sets.

    In case of With a Little Help from My Friends, for example, 1999 YSS mix centers the drums, but 2017 mix does not (because apparently drums in the center changed quality of Ringo's voice).

    As for "demixing", they probably used it anyway but in places where it produces the least artifacts like a track that has bass guitar and a tambourine, that is easily separated. As for other methods, Giles himself said that they used ADT on some stuff - he was demonstrating it on the intro guitar of Dear Prudence, saying that they used it (the same ADT machine Beatles used) to make a "stereo" out of original mono track guitar. Apparently, they used it quite a lot as well, but also made some weird choices with it (like bass in Dear Prudence).
